Professional Application Guide
Step-by-step instructions for optimal performance and long-lasting results
Surface Preparation
Clean, dry, and free from oils, grease, rust, loose particles or peeling coatings. Repair and prime metal or porous concrete if required.
Mixing Procedure
Stir thoroughly before application to ensure proper consistency and performance. Follow manufacturer guidelines for optimal results.
Application Methods
Use airless spray, industrial roller, or brush with wet film thickness 250-300 microns per coat for uniform coverage.
Drying & Curing
4-6 hours between coats, full curing 48-72 hours. Suitable application conditions 5°C to 45°C, RH<85%.
Safety Precautions
Ensure proper ventilation, use PPE (gloves, goggles, mask), store in cool dry place, avoid application in high humidity or extreme temperatures.
Quality Assurance
Inspect each coat for uniform application and proper thickness. Document application process for compliance and warranty purposes.

Coverage Information
First Time/New Surface
30-40 sqft per litre per coat
Repainting/Existing Surface
40-50 sqft per litre per coat
